Repair of upvc windows: Cost
The kind of window and the work needed will determine the price of repairs to upvc windows near me. The majority of repairs to double-paned window are more costly than a single pane window.
It is possible to replace the seals of your window and hinges. A broken window spring may make the sash stuck when you try to open the window. A lock or handle that is broken will make your window vulnerable to burglars.
Windows may need to be repaired for a variety of reasons. A few of them are broken or cracked panes, loose or misaligned hinges, or broken glass. Other causes include faulty seals or a malfunctioning balance or spring.
If you're looking to find a cheap solution to fix your window DIY window repair using upvc could be the solution. Before you begin it's essential to be aware of how much you'll pay for the repairs.
It's cheaper to replace a one pane of glass than to replace the entire window according to the majority of homeowners. It is possible to save hundreds of dollars by repairing your windows instead of replacing them.
The costs for replacing windows that are damaged can be extremely high, but. They can be costly due to the potential for wood rot caused by moisture exposure. When you replace the frame, you'll have to remove all of the damaged sections and replace them with new wood.
Depending on the size of your window, you'll pay between $75-$300 to have your windows fixed. It's important to know that you'll need a couple to complete the task in addition to having more than one window it's likely that you'll save money.
You'll need to purchase the screen if you want to replace your window screens. Screens cost a bit more, in relation to their thickness and mesh material. Replacement screens can be as low as $150 up to $350.
In addition to the material that you'll need for repairing your upvc window You will also have to think about the amount of time required to complete the work. You can look up quotes online to determine what you can afford.
